Blood Howl Details and Upgrades

Blood Howl

Blood Howl

Shapeshift into a Werewolf and howl furiously, Healing you for 20% of your Maximum Life.

Cooldown: 15 seconds

Tags: Defensive, Werewolf, Shapeshifting

Upgrades

Upgrade Hub
Enhanced Blood Howl

Kills reduce the cooldown of Blood Howl by 1 second.

Upgrade Hub
Innate Blood Howl

Blood Howl also generates 20 Spirit.

Upgrade Hub
Preserving Blood Howl

Blood Howl also increases your Attack Speed by +15% for 4 seconds.
